The thing about genes though, is that they cannot just be turned off or on, they get turned up and down as a result of epigentic factors. Also every gene has multiple snps (pronounced snips), each snp is like a dimmer switch and effects how the gene is being expressed.

So say someone has a gene for blue eyes, depending on the expression of said genes the person could actually have green eyes.

Basic genetic testing does not delve into how a gene is expressing itself, it only looks at predisposition.

So being able to identify what someone would look like, to a great extent is still very much guess work, because your guessing the extent to which the gene is expressing.

Determining race or ancestry looks at something different though. It basically looks at patterns of genes present known as phenotypes or genotypes. And because they frequently see certain combination in certain populations they can determine ancestral roots, but not neccasrily how these roots have expressed themselves in terms of appearance for a given person.
